Shikinai Tatehara Shrine
式内楯原神社
Shikinai Tatehara Shrine, a historic Osaka shrine, offers a glimpse into local Shinto traditions.
What it is
- A Shikinaisha, formerly a village shrine.
- Not affiliated with the Association of Shinto Shrines.
- Dedicated to Takemikazuchi no Okami and Okuninushi no Okami.
What to see
- Main hall, built between 1615 and 1623.
- Main hall is an Osaka City tangible cultural property.
- Offering hall, worship hall, and Kagura hall.
- Ema hall and shrine office.
When to go
- Summer festival on July 5th.
- Autumn festival on October 15th.
